tcp为什么是三次握手而不是两次握手
主要是为了防止第一次握手时超时,导致二次握手成功后,已经在连接状态
而超时后会再次发出握手请求,这样相当于连接了两次,造成资源浪费
tcp四次握手可以不
每次握手都是对收到上次握手的确认,却不能保证本次握手就能顺利到达。换句话说,
握手发出的那一刻,只能说明上一次消息传递是顺畅的,却不能保证现在网络是畅通的。
所以陷入死循环,无论多少次握手,严格意义上来说都不能保证建立可靠连接,但三次握手是最优选择
什么是四次握手(侵删)
tcp为什么是三次握手而不是两次握手
主要是为了防止第一次握手时超时,导致二次握手成功后,已经在连接状态
而超时后会再次发出握手请求,这样相当于连接了两次,造成资源浪费
tcp四次握手可以不
每次握手都是对收到上次握手的确认,却不能保证本次握手就能顺利到达。换句话说,
握手发出的那一刻,只能说明上一次消息传递是顺畅的,却不能保证现在网络是畅通的。
所以陷入死循环,无论多少次握手,严格意义上来说都不能保证建立可靠连接,但三次握手是最优选择
什么是四次握手(侵删)